    What is the percentage of acetic acid present in vinegar?

    A) 6-10%                                   

    B) 70-80%

    C) 7-8%                                     

    D) 90-100%

    Correct Answer: C

    Solution :

    Vinegar is 7-8% solution, of acetic acid. Acetic acid is commercially prepared from molasses (by product of sugar industry). \[{{C}_{12}}{{H}_{22}}{{O}_{11}}+HOH\xrightarrow[(Invertase)]{yeast}\underset{glu\cos e}{\mathop{{{C}_{6}}{{H}_{12}}{{O}_{6}}}}\,+\underset{Fructose}{\mathop{{{C}_{6}}{{H}_{12}}{{O}_{6}}}}\,\] \[{{C}_{6}}{{H}_{12}}{{O}_{6}}\xrightarrow[(Zymase)]{yeast}2{{C}_{2}}{{H}_{5}}OH+C{{O}_{2}}\] \[\underset{(air)}{\mathop{{{C}_{2}}{{H}_{5}}OH}}\,+{{O}_{2}}\xrightarrow{acetobacter}C{{H}_{3}}COOH\]
